The Longest Night
A beautiful woman turns to prostitution. She must surrender her income to the leader of a human trafficking ring, but her daughter’s illness and a...
See morePRND
Place your hands on the wheel, Ride into the red, Never looking back again we'll Drive until your dead.
See more